ארז ליברמן
משתמש צעיר
שלום לכולם.
סוף סוף התחלתי ללמוד as3 בצורה מסודרת - אז יש לי שאלה בשיעורי בית.
למרות שבניתי כבר די הרבה אתרי פלאש בas2 הידע שלי במשתנים,תנאים וכ' די בסיס - תקבלו בהבנה...
מה שאני צריך לעשות זה ככה :יש לי 3 שורות של from x to x,from y to y ,from alpha to alpha שבהם יש שדות של משתני טקסט.
האוביקט שבבמה צריך לזוז מאחד לשני.
מה שהצלחתי לעשות בנתיים זה שיש 2 כפתורים הראשון ממקם את האוביקט במיקום הראשון והשני מזיז אותו לעבר המיקום השני אבל זה עובד רק אם המיקום שני גדול יותר מהמיקום הראשון.
הקוד הוא ככה:
btn.addEventListener(MouseEvent.CLICK, clickme);
btn2.addEventListener(MouseEvent.CLICK, moveme);
function clickme(event:MouseEvent):void
{
mc.x = Number(x1.text)
mc.y = Number(y1.text)
mc.alpha = Number(a1.text)
}
function moveme(event:MouseEvent):void
{
if
(mc.x<Number(x2.text))
{
mc.x +=10
}
else{
mc.x=Number(x2.text)
}
if
(mc.y<Number(y2.text))
{
mc.y +=10
}
else{
mc.y=Number(y2.text)
}
if
(mc.alpha<Number(a2.text))
{
mc.alpha +=0.1
}
else{
mc.alpha=Number(a2.text)
}
}
r
אשמח לעזרה,להסברים ולעצות איך לעשות שהאוביקט יוכל לזוז ממיקום למיקום גם כהשני יותר גדול,קטן וכ'.
תודה.
ארז.
סוף סוף התחלתי ללמוד as3 בצורה מסודרת - אז יש לי שאלה בשיעורי בית.
למרות שבניתי כבר די הרבה אתרי פלאש בas2 הידע שלי במשתנים,תנאים וכ' די בסיס - תקבלו בהבנה...
מה שאני צריך לעשות זה ככה :יש לי 3 שורות של from x to x,from y to y ,from alpha to alpha שבהם יש שדות של משתני טקסט.
האוביקט שבבמה צריך לזוז מאחד לשני.
מה שהצלחתי לעשות בנתיים זה שיש 2 כפתורים הראשון ממקם את האוביקט במיקום הראשון והשני מזיז אותו לעבר המיקום השני אבל זה עובד רק אם המיקום שני גדול יותר מהמיקום הראשון.
הקוד הוא ככה:
btn.addEventListener(MouseEvent.CLICK, clickme);
btn2.addEventListener(MouseEvent.CLICK, moveme);
function clickme(event:MouseEvent):void
{
mc.x = Number(x1.text)
mc.y = Number(y1.text)
mc.alpha = Number(a1.text)
}
function moveme(event:MouseEvent):void
{
if
(mc.x<Number(x2.text))
{
mc.x +=10
}
else{
mc.x=Number(x2.text)
}
if
(mc.y<Number(y2.text))
{
mc.y +=10
}
else{
mc.y=Number(y2.text)
}
if
(mc.alpha<Number(a2.text))
{
mc.alpha +=0.1
}
else{
mc.alpha=Number(a2.text)
}
}
r
אשמח לעזרה,להסברים ולעצות איך לעשות שהאוביקט יוכל לזוז ממיקום למיקום גם כהשני יותר גדול,קטן וכ'.
תודה.
ארז.